Yutoku Inari Shrine

Home to "Yutoku", the god for good business, the five grains, and large harvests, this shrine has long been loved and is one of the three major Inari Okami shrines. The shrine has Ohitaki bonfires, introduces Shinto religious services and prayers, and bad-omen years.

Sachihime Shuzou Co., Ltd.

The sacred sake is brewed near Yutoku Inari Shrine, one of the 3 greatest Inari shrines in Japan. It has been about 30 years since this sake brewery was open to show the process of sake-making. They are the first one in Kyushu to sell local-sake soft serve ice cream and the first in Japan to serve Doburoku (unrefined sake) ice cream. Not on the refined sake but also the plum wine made with sake is popular.

Apr-May: Azalea at Yutoku Inari Shrine

Higashiyama Park located across the bridge from the main shrine site turns to an azalea garden featuring as many as 50 thousand azaleas. The beautiful view created by 40 kinds of azalea flowers is breathtaking. Wisteria, iris and peony at the Japanese garden will also be in their best time for viewing one after another and the park will be a paradise of flowers.

Sep: Kashima Traditional Arts Festival

It is an event held in Kashima-City, where the most number of traditional arts remain in Saga. Performers from all over Saga will gather on the grounds of Yutoku Inari Shrine to share various traditional arts such as Memburyu.

Dec: Yutoku Inari Shrine Ohitaki

Ohitaki is a traditional ritual held at night as a part of the ceremonial offering that has been performed for over 300 years. It is believed that getting close to the divine fire purifies you of sins and foulness. Kashima City's Specialty Fair is held on the same day to promote the city's specialty products.

March Cherry Blossoms of Yutoku Inari Shrine

This shrine is one of Japan's three largest Inari Shrines (Sandai Inari) together with Fushimi Inari Shrine and Kasama Inari Shrine. The bright vermilion color of the monument is very impressive, and major monuments such as the shrine, the worship hall, the tower gate, etc. are lacquered. Cherry blossoms and Taiwan cherry blossoms in the outer garden are the spring traditions.

June Hydrangeas of Yutoku Inari Shrine

The "Japanese garden" beside the main hall is a full-scale garden with small streams and bridges. 600 pots of hydrangeas will bloom one after another and it is enjoyable until late June. This is a very picturesque spot. Moreover, a lot of hydrangeas are also found on the river beside the precincts. This is beautiful spot even on rainy days.

Nov - Dec Autumn Leaves of Yutoku Inari Shrine

Yutoku Inari Shrine is one of Japan's three largest Inari Shrines (Sandai Inari). In autumn, red leaves not only dye the precincts in red, but also bring a different color to the Japanese garden.
